
Man's ultimate sacrifice to save Toowoomba girl's life
A YOUNG Toowoomba girl has thanked the brother of the man who died saving her from drowning on the NSW north coast.
Rihanna Milabo, 7, was rescued from the ocean at Fingal Headlands in New South Wales on Good Friday along with her parents Shyra and Rickel.
Ryan Martin has been hailed a hero for trying to shield Rihanna from the jagged rocks and waves.
Mr Martin, 30, was farewelled in a memorial yesterday at the same place where he died near a cliff face close to Giant's Causeway.
The Milabo family was hesitant to make contact with the Martin family, but joined with them at Mr Martin's memorial to thank him for his heroic actions.
The Milabo family is now calling for him to be honoured with a bravery award.
